Detailed explanation-1: -Quickly zoom in or out On the status bar of your Office app, click the zoom slider. Slide to the percentage zoom setting that you want. Click-or + to zoom in gradual increments.

Detailed explanation-2: -While delivering your presentation and using presenter view, you can magnify part of the slide on the screen. In the lower right-hand corner of your slide, click Slide Show view. In the lower left corner of the presenter view, click the magnifying glass icon.

Detailed explanation-3: -Zoom Slider, that is also known as Zoom Bar, is the slider available in all the Microsoft products that allow the user to zoom in and zoom out of a document without having to press any commands or keys. Detailed explanation-4: -The Zoom slider in PowerPoint appears in the lower-right corner of the application window in the Status Bar. You use this tool to change the magnification level of the slide.
